Theodore Spikes the River Double

Level 28 : Blinds 60,000/120,000, 120,000 ante

Kevin Theodore raised and then faced a three-bet to 675,000 by Alex Keating in the cutoff. Theodore moved all-in for 1,695,000 and Keating eventually called.

Kevin Theodore: AK All in
Alex Keating: KQ

Keating took the lead with the Q98 flop and retained it on the 2 turn to leave Theodore on the ropes. However, the tides turned on the A river as Theodore hit the ace to survive.

Garcia Finds Aces But Chops Against Gonzalez's Queens

Level 28 : Blinds 60,000/120,000, 120,000 ante
Andres Gonzalez
Andres Gonzalez

Adrian Garcia opened to 240,000 from under the gun and Jason Sagle called from early position. Andres Gonzalez then three-bet to 900,000 from middle position, then Garcia shoved for around 2,000,000 once it folded back to him. Sagle folded, but Gonzalez called.

Adrian Garcia: AA All in
Andres Gonzalez: QQ

Garcia had found the perfect spot to double up and his pocket aces remained in the lead on the 967 flop. A 10 on the turn did bring some chop outs, and the 8 river gave both players a straight, which meant they chopped the pot.

Coelho Plays Power Poker Against Vaysman

Level 28 : Blinds 60,000/120,000, 120,000 ante
Diogo Coelho
Diogo Coelho

Marc Wolpert raised to 250,000 under the gun before Justin Vaysman three-bet to 725,000 in early position. Diogo Coelho then four-bet to 1,425,000 in middle position, Wolpert folded, while Vaysman pulled his hood over his head and called.

The flop came 9J2 and Coelho bet 720,000. Vaysman took a few minutes before calling to the K turn.

Coelho then bet 1,560,000, sending Vaysman deep into the tank once again. He took nearly five minutes before folding.

"Show the bluff for the cameras," tablemate Naor Slobodskoy told Coelho as a large crowd gathered around the table while the hand was in progress. Coelho didn't oblige and returned his cards face down.

Han Spikes Turn to Double Through Lhuillier

Level 28 : Blinds 60,000/120,000, 120,000 ante
Yong Han
Yong Han

Yong Han open-jammed a stack of around 1,700,000 from early position and Jean Lhuillier called on the button with a bigger stack.

Yong Han: AK All in
Jean Lhuillier: QQ

Han stood from his seat when he saw he was against queens and started to leave as the flop landed 725. The A then landed on the turn and Han cheered and returned to his seat as the 8 bricked off on the river to earn him a double.

Garcia Stacks Hamilton

Level 28 : Blinds 60,000/120,000, 120,000 ante
Joe Hamilton
Joe Hamilton

Adrian Garcia opened from middle position to 240,000 and Joe Hamilton shoved from the small blind for around 1,100,000. The big blind folded, and Garcia made the call which put Hamilton at risk.

Joe Hamilton: 77 All in
Adrian Garcia: AK

Hamilton's rail exploded with encouragement in this flip situation.

"Seven, seven!" they shouted.

There wasn't a seven on the flop but instead it improved Garcia to trips as the dealer put 10KK onto the baize. More cries of "seven" came from the rail but neither the 6 turn nor Q river could save Hamilton from elimination.

Big Slick Does the Trick For Wolpert

Level 28 : Blinds 60,000/120,000, 120,000 ante

Giovanni Zanette raised from middle position and was three-bet top 725,000 by Marc Wolpert on the button. Action folded back to Zanette, who called.

Both players checked on the Q3A flop and then Zanette check-called a 525,000 bet from Wolpert on the 5 turn.

The 7 completed the board and Zanette checked once more. Wolpert put an even million into the middle and Zanette decided to look Wolpert up after a bit of thought.

Wolpert tabled AK for top pair, top kicker and Zanette flung his hand into the muck.
